Understanding Roofline Repairs: Everything You Need to Know
Roofs play a crucial role in securing a residential or commercial property, acting as the very first line of defense versus Nature's aspects. Nevertheless, the roofline, that includes not just the roof material itself but also the essential parts like fascias, soffits, and guttering, and requires routine maintenance and repairs to make sure optimal performance. Roofline repairs can be intricate and are typically required to avoid small problems from escalating into expensive issues. This article will cover the important aspects of roofline repairs, including their value, typical issues, repair alternatives, and regularly asked questions.

Split and Damaged Fascia
Fascias are board-like structures that run horizontally along the roofline and hold the guttering in location. In time, direct exposure to the aspects can cause them to split or become warped. Prompt replacement or repair of the fascia can prevent water from dripping into the roof and damaging the structure of the home.
2. Soffit Decay
Soffits cover the area underneath the roofline repair, providing ventilation and preventing pests from entering the attic. Moisture can trigger soffits to rot, jeopardizing their functionality. Replacement of damaged soffits can boost both aesthetics and ventilation.
3. Gutter Maintenance
Gutters collect rainwater from the roof and funnel it away from the home's structure. When seamless gutters are blocked with particles, they can overflow, causing substantial water damage. Routine cleaning and maintenance are essential to ensure proper drainage.
4. Checking Downpipes
Downpipes channel water from gutters to a drain system. Disconnections or obstructions in these pipelines can lead to water pooling, which can erode the foundation. Routine checks are required to make sure all parts are undamaged.
Repair Options for Rooflines
When it concerns roofline repairs, property owners have several choices to consider:
A. DIY Repairs
For small issues, such as cleaning gutters or changing a few fascia boards, DIY repairs can be efficient. Before case, individuals must assess their skill level and security.
B. Professional Repair Services
For extensive damage or if confidence in a DIY approach is doing not have, working with a professional roofing contractor is advisable. They provide expertise and quality work while guaranteeing security.
C. Preventative Measures
Integrating routine maintenance into property care can assist prevent many roofline problems. This can include:
Regular cleansing of seamless gutters and downpipes.Yearly examinations of roofline elements.Trigger repairs of any acknowledged damage.

Frequently Asked Questions about Roofline Repairs
1. How frequently should I inspect my roofline?
It is advisable to inspect your roofline at least as soon as a year, preferably during the spring and fall.
2. What signs indicate a need for roofline repairs?
Signs include visible cracks, peeling paint on fascias, blocked rain gutters, and sagging soffits.
3. Can I repair roofline issues in the winter season?
While some minor repairs might be practical, it is usually best to wait for warmer weather condition due to the risk of ice and snow.
4. How can I lengthen the life of my roofline?
Routine maintenance, such as cleaning up seamless gutters and looking for damage, can substantially extend the life-span of roofline elements.
